What to do if the lucky bamboo leaves are dry

1. Too much watering

1. Symptoms: If you give it too much water often, its leaves will become dull and dry, the old leaves will not change obviously, the roots will be very thin, and the new treetops will not grow big.

2. Method: Reduce the amount of watering at normal times. If the situation is very serious, you need to change the pot and place it in a cool area to dry for a while. Wait until the soil is dry before transplanting it to the new pot. Under normal circumstances, if it is grown in water, do not change the water frequently. Change it once every three to five days. If the water evaporates, just add water. If you change the water too frequently, the leaves will dry out. Wipe its leaves frequently to keep it cleaner.

2. Too little watering

1. Symptoms: If it is grown in soil, it is not watered regularly, or the amount of water is too little, the leaves will dry up, and the old leaves will slowly fall from the base upwards. Generally, the newly grown leaves will be more normal.

2. Method: Water it immediately, but not too much at once. Water it a little at first, and then water it thoroughly after two hours until it adapts. You should pay attention to watering it during normal maintenance and not leave it alone, as it loves water very much.

3. Too much fertilizer

1. Symptoms: If the dosage or frequency of fertilization is too much, the tips of its new leaves will wither and the entire old leaves will turn yellow and fall off. Even though the leaves are thick and look shiny, they are not smooth.

2. Method: First, stop fertilizing it immediately, and then water it with clean water to help it drain out the excess fertilizer. If it really cannot be drained out, change it to a new pot.

4. Too little fertilizer

1. Symptoms: If you only water it regularly but don't fertilize it, or if you don't repot it for many years, its roots will clump together and its leaves will dry out.

2. Method: Replace the pot with a new one in time and apply fertilizer more often but in smaller amounts. Normally, don't let it be exposed to direct sunlight, otherwise the tips of the leaves will dry out. Place it in a cool area.
